#b3298a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3298a is composed of 70.2% red, 16.1%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.1% magenta, 22.9%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 317.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 43.1%. #b3298a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#670015.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

● #b3298a color description : Strong pink.
#b3298a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3298a has RGB values of R:179, G:41,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.23,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11741578.

Shades and Tints of #b3298a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b3298a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6d6f is the less saturated color, while #d50798 is the most saturated one.
